About Georgia Tech
Georgia Tech is a top-ranked public research university situated in the heart of Atlanta, a diverse and vibrant city with numerous economic and cultural strengths. The Institute serves more than 45,000 students through top-ranked undergraduate, graduate, and executive programs in engineering, computing, science, business, design, and liberal arts. Georgia Tech's faculty attracted more than $1.4 billion in research awards this past year in fields ranging from biomedical technology to artificial intelligence, energy, sustainability, semiconductors, neuroscience, and national security. Georgia Tech ranks among the nation's top 20 universities for research and development spending and No. 1 among institutions without a medical school.

Department Information
The Georgia Tech Athletic Association (GTAA) sponsors varsity intercollegiate athletics competition in 17 NCAA Division I sports for the Georgia Institute of Technology. We are a proud member of the Atlantic Coast Conference. Steeped in history and success while embracing strategic innovation, our programs compete at the highest level and strive for national championships. Tech fans are passionate about their support of their beloved Yellow Jackets and cherish the many traditions involved with the program.

Job Summary


Assist with the daily operations related to recruiting student athletes. This position will interact on a regular basis with: staff, coaches, current and potential students and parents. This position typically will advise and counsel: staff, coaches, potential students and parents. This position will supervise: NA.

Responsibilities


Job Duty 1 -
Initiate and maintain effective communications in order to identify program prospects.
Job Duty 2 -
Maintain prospect recruiting database for program.
Job Duty 3 -
Coordinate academic review and advising, course scheduling and communicate as appropriate with coaching staff.
Job Duty 4 -
Oversee the collection of personal, academic and athletic information and/or documents for selected prospects and student athletes.
Job Duty 5 -
Plan and oversee official and unofficial visits to campus by prospective student-athletes for program.
Job Duty 6 -
Perform other duties as assigned

Required Qualifications


Educational Requirements
Bachelor's Degree in Sports Administration, Exercise Science or related field or equivalent combination of education and experience
Required Experience
Two to three years of job related experience

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ities


SKILLS
Ability to effectively communicate, organizational skills, and proficiency with databases
